Core Components of the 4x4 System
The 4x4 system is the heart of the Ford Ranger Sport's off-road capabilities. It's what allows the truck to conquer challenging terrains. The 4x4 system in the Ford Ranger is typically an electronic shift-on-the-fly system, meaning you can switch between two-wheel drive (2WD) and four-wheel drive (4WD) modes with the turn of a dial. This provides added convenience and flexibility, allowing you to quickly adapt to changing road conditions. Here's a breakdown of the key components of the 4x4 system:
- Transfer Case: This is the central component that directs power to both the front and rear axles in 4WD mode. The transfer case splits the engine's power, sending it to the front and rear wheels to provide additional traction. The Ranger often features a two-speed transfer case, which includes a low-range gear for extreme off-road situations where maximum torque is needed.
- Front and Rear Differentials: Differentials are responsible for allowing the wheels on each axle to rotate at different speeds. This is crucial for cornering, as the outside wheels travel a greater distance than the inside wheels. The Ranger may be equipped with an electronic locking rear differential, which can lock the rear wheels together to provide maximum traction in slippery conditions.
- Electronic Controls: Modern 4x4 systems are controlled by sophisticated electronic systems that monitor wheel speed, throttle position, and other factors to optimize traction and stability. These systems can automatically distribute power to the wheels with the most grip, helping to prevent wheel spin and maintain control.
- Drive Shafts: These connect the transfer case to the front and rear axles, transmitting power to the wheels. They are ruggedly built to withstand the stresses of off-road driving.
Understanding how these components work together gives you a better appreciation for the Ford Ranger Sport 4x4's off-road prowess. It's not just about having four-wheel drive; it's about having a well-engineered system that can handle a variety of challenging conditions, from muddy trails to rocky climbs.

Off-Road Features That Make a Difference
The Ford Ranger Sport 4x4 is designed to take on off-road adventures. Several features set it apart from other trucks. The features make a huge difference when you're out on the trails. Let's explore some of them:
- High Ground Clearance: Ground clearance refers to the distance between the lowest part of the truck and the ground. A higher ground clearance allows the Ranger Sport to clear obstacles like rocks, logs, and uneven terrain without damaging its undercarriage. The Sport package often includes specific modifications to increase ground clearance.
- Skid Plates: Skid plates are protective panels that are mounted underneath the truck to shield vital components like the engine, transmission, and fuel tank from damage. When navigating rocky terrain, skid plates can help prevent these components from being struck by rocks and other hazards.
- Electronic Locking Rear Differential: This is a key feature for off-road performance. It allows the rear wheels to turn at the same speed, providing maximum traction in slippery conditions. When one wheel starts to spin, the locking differential sends power to the other wheel, helping to maintain forward momentum.
- Terrain Management System: This system allows you to select different driving modes based on the terrain you're driving on. These modes adjust the engine, transmission, and traction control settings to optimize performance for specific conditions, such as sand, mud, snow, or rocks.
- Hill Descent Control: This feature automatically controls the truck's speed when descending steep grades, allowing you to focus on steering. It's especially useful when navigating challenging off-road descents where maintaining a slow, controlled speed is essential.
- Off-Road Suspension: The Sport package often includes a specifically tuned suspension system. This may include upgraded shocks, springs, and other components that are designed to absorb bumps and impacts, providing a smoother and more controlled ride on rough terrain.
- All-Terrain Tires: These tires are designed to provide a balance of on-road comfort and off-road capability. They have aggressive tread patterns that offer good traction in a variety of conditions, from mud and snow to rocks and gravel.
All these features, when combined, create a very capable off-road package. They ensure that the Ford Ranger Sport 4x4 can handle various off-road challenges and provide a thrilling and safe driving experience.
